Running For Cover Poem by Kent Krauss

Running For Cover



When you know you've done the wrong thing or made a catastrophic mistake
You tend to want some help in evading the consequences for the actions you take
To lessen your looking too dimwitted or incompetent in the environment where you are
And to allow you the appearance of having done what could be considered better than par
But to do that, you'd have to take action that might repair or at least mitigate damage
Which again leaves you scrambling to think of something that might better your image
